diff --git a/apps/web/src/components/layout/components/v2/HeaderNav.tsx b/apps/web/src/components/layout/components/v2/HeaderNav.tsx index ec083da9c2d..39ef8f7e4e9 100644 --- a/apps/web/src/components/layout/components/v2/HeaderNav.tsx +++ b/apps/web/src/components/layout/components/v2/HeaderNav.tsx @@ -14,18 +14,14 @@ import { NotificationCenterWidget } from '../NotificationCenterWidget'; import { HeaderMenuItems } from './HeaderMenuItems'; import { UserProfileButton } from '../../../../ee/clerk'; import { BridgeMenuItems } from './BridgeMenuItems'; -import { useStudioState } from '../../../../studio/StudioStateProvider'; import { WorkflowHeaderBackButton } from './WorkflowHeaderBackButton'; export function HeaderNav() { const { currentUser } = useAuth(); - const { bridgeURL } = useStudioState(); const isSelfHosted = IS_SELF_HOSTED; const isV2Enabled = useFeatureFlag(FeatureFlagsKeysEnum.IS_V2_ENABLED); - const shouldShowNewNovuExperience = isV2Enabled && bridgeURL; - useBootIntercom(); const { Icon, themeLabel, toggleColorScheme } = useThemeChange(); @@ -43,9 +39,11 @@ export function HeaderNav() { > {/* TODO: Change position: right to space-between for breadcrumbs */} - {shouldShowNewNovuExperience && } + + + - {shouldShowNewNovuExperience && } + {isV2Enabled && } toggleColorScheme()}>
diff --git a/apps/web/src/ee/clerk/components/QuestionnaireForm.tsx b/apps/web/src/ee/clerk/components/QuestionnaireForm.tsx index 776ef6d1f74..2bcc8189682 100644 --- a/apps/web/src/ee/clerk/components/QuestionnaireForm.tsx +++ b/apps/web/src/ee/clerk/components/QuestionnaireForm.tsx @@ -1,4 +1,4 @@ -import { useEffect, useState } from 'react'; +import { useState } from 'react'; import { useLocation, useNavigate, useSearchParams } from 'react-router-dom'; import { Controller, useForm } from 'react-hook-form'; import { useMutation } from '@tanstack/react-query'; @@ -16,7 +16,7 @@ import { Button, inputStyles, Select } from '@novu/design-system'; import styled from '@emotion/styled/macro'; import { api } from '../../../api/api.client'; import { useAuth } from '../../../hooks/useAuth'; -import { useFeatureFlag, useVercelIntegration, useVercelParams, useEffectOnce, useContainer } from '../../../hooks'; +import { useFeatureFlag, useVercelIntegration } from '../../../hooks'; import { ROUTES } from '../../../constants/routes'; import { useSegment } from '../../../components/providers/SegmentProvider'; import { BRIDGE_SYNC_SAMPLE_ENDPOINT } from '../../../config/index'; @@ -31,7 +31,6 @@ function updateClerkOrgMetadata(data: UpdateExternalOrganizationDto) { export function QuestionnaireForm() { const { isSupported } = useWebContainerSupported(); - const isV2Enabled = useFeatureFlag(FeatureFlagsKeysEnum.IS_V2_ENABLED); const isPlaygroundOnboardingEnabled = useFeatureFlag(FeatureFlagsKeysEnum.IS_PLAYGROUND_ONBOARDING_ENABLED); const [loading, setLoading] = useState(); const {